Senior Airman James Langley, a 19th Operations Support Squadron air traffic controller, types in clearances for departure Feb. 28, 2013, at Little Rock Air Force Base, Ark. The 19th OSS is one of many squadrons that operate on a 24-hour basis. (U.S. Air Force photo by Senior Airman Rusty Frank)
